In the complex and high-stakes environment of electrical facilities on the Sydney peninsula, the specialized knowledge of a Level 2 Electrician North Shore is important, not just as an important resource however also as an obligatory requirement. As Accredited Service Providers, these professionals hold the exclusive legal consent to carry out jobs that are off-limits to common electricians. Unlike basic electricians who focus on internal circuitry, Level 2 here Electricians North Shore are certified to work on the electricity distribution network itself, including the essential connection point between the main street power supply and specific properties. This vital work demands advanced technical knowledge and rigorous compliance with safety requirements imposed by suppliers such as Ausgrid. Offered the peninsula's varied landscape of older and more recent advancements, the participation of a Level 2 Electrician North Shore is essential to keeping a safe, reputable, and compliant energy supply, ensuring the uninterrupted circulation of power to homes without jeopardizing security or residential or commercial property.

The duties designated to a Level 2 Electrician North Shore are typically categorized into 4 key locations, each relating to different elements of the grid-level facilities. Class 2A particularly includes the disconnection and reconnection of service lines, a service that is frequently needed during considerable home restorations or to ensure the security of other employees in close proximity to live wires. Class 2B focuses on managing underground service wiring, which has actually become more common in modern advancements focusing on visual appeals and durability against storms. When it comes to older or more traditional homes, a Level 2 Electrician North Shore is charged with Class 2C tasks related to overhead service line maintenance, such as repairing accessory points and setting up personal power poles.

Class 2D incorporates network service equipment such as meters and service security merges. This broad variety of know-how makes sure that when jobs like setting up a wise meter to track solar exports or changing a lumber pole impacted by weather conditions need to be done, a North Shore Level 2 Electrician is the sole qualified private capable of safely connecting utility and private usage.

Citizens often turn to Level 2 Electricians in the North Shore when they receive a defect notification from a network supplier, which is a common event due to the location's abundant tree growth. Tree branches regularly trigger problems with overhead lines, positioning fire dangers and network instability. Upon identifying these dangers, inspectors release notifications with strict deadlines for homeowner to deal with the problems. Level 2 Electricians in the North Shore are authorized to address these flaws by performing essential repairs, such as installing protective tiger tails or repairing UV-damaged consumer mains. They also supply the essential Certificate of Compliance to ensure constant power supply. Failing to attend to these notifications without delay can lead to supply disconnection, underscoring the significance of a speedy response from Level 2 Electricians in the North Shore for maintaining household or business operations. Their competence in local network standards enables them to navigate the Ausgrid network bureaucracy effectively, making sure compliance with all safety policies.

In addition to handling repairs and making sure regulatory compliance, a Level 2 Electrician North Shore plays a vital function in boosting a property's electrical facilities to support the needs of contemporary lifestyles. The increasing adoption of electric vehicles and advanced air conditioning systems in local homes is often at odds with outdated single-phase power systems, leading to recurring electrical problems and voltage changes. To resolve this, a Level 2 Electrician North Shore can carry out a three-phase power upgrade, substantially enhancing the property's electrical capability and making it possible for the safe, synchronised operation of numerous high-power devices. This intricate procedure needs specialized know-how, including adjustments to the primary electrical connections, the setup of new service fuses, and the upgrading of electrical metering systems.

Furthermore, with the increasing shift towards sustainable energy, it is important to have a Level 2 Electrician in the North Shore location for the proper setup of solar-compatible meters that facilitate feed-in tariffs.
